Kako lahko pridobim izkušnje v Rustu?

Zadnja posodobitev: 01.02.2024

Kako lahko pridobim izkušnje v Rustu?

Uvod
Rust je sodoben programski jezik, osredotočen na varnost, sočasnost in zmogljivost. Njegova priljubljenost v zadnjih letih narašča zaradi sposobnosti pisanja varne in učinkovite kode. Če vas zanima pridobite izkušnje v Rustu, Prišli ste na pravo mesto. V tem članku bomo raziskali nekaj ključnih strategij in virov, ki vam bodo pomagali pridobiti veščine tega razburljivega jezika.

Naučite se osnov Rusta
Preden se podate v pridobivanje praktičnih izkušenj z Rustom, je bistveno, da dobro razumete njegove osnove. Rust se edinstveno osredotoča na varnost spomina, zato je bistveno razumeti koncepte, kot so lastništvo, izposoja, življenjski cikel in brisanje. Če se boste seznanili s sintakso in značilnimi značilnostmi Rusta, boste dobili trdne temelje za napredovanje na poti do strokovnega znanja v tem jeziku.

Odprtokodni projekti
Odličen način za pridobivanje praktičnih izkušenj z Rustom je prispevanje k odprtokodnim projektom. Sodelovanje v obstoječih projektih vam bo omogočilo delo na pravi kodi in sodelovanje z drugimi razvijalci. Iskanje odprtokodnih projektov ki vas zanima in ki uporablja Rust je a učinkovito uporabiti v praksi tvoje znanje in izboljšajte svoje sposobnosti. Poleg tega vam lahko ponudi priložnost, da se učite od drugih in prejmete povratne informacije o svojem delu.

Razvoj osebnih projektov
Razvijanje osebnih projektov je še en učinkovit način za pridobivanje izkušenj v Rustu. Z ustvarjanjem lastnih aplikacij, knjižnic ali orodij se lahko spopadete s posebnimi izzivi in ​​uporabite edinstvene rešitve. Začnete lahko z majhnimi projekti in jih postopoma povečujete, ko pridobite več izkušenj. Ta praksa vam tudi pomaga, da se seznanite s potekom dela in orodji, ki se uporabljajo za razvoj v Rustu.

Vadnice in spletni viri
Veliko število vadnic in spletnih virov so na voljo za pomoč pri pridobivanju izkušenj v Rustu. Najdete lahko vse od spletnih tečajev do uradne dokumentacije in podrobnih vaj. Ti viri nudijo praktične informacije in vas vodijo skozi vaje in projekte. korak za korakom. Ne pozabite izkoristiti teh virov, da okrepite svoje spretnosti in razširite svoje znanje v Rustu.

Sodelovanje v skupnostih in študijskih skupinah
Nenazadnje je lahko sodelovanje v skupnostih in študijskih skupinah zelo koristno pri pridobivanju izkušenj v Rustu. Pridružitev forumom, skupinam za razprave ali spletnim skupnostim vam omogoča interakcijo z bolj izkušenimi razvijalci in postavljanje posebnih vprašanj o jeziku. Poleg tega vam bo sodelovanje z drugimi študenti ali strokovnjaki pomagalo najti rešitve za zahtevne težave in izboljšati vaše splošno razumevanje Rusta.

Zaključek
Za pridobivanje izkušenj z Rustom je pomembno združiti učenje osnov jezika z dejansko prakso na odprtokodnih ali osebnih projektih. Poleg tega izkoristite spletne vire in sodelujte v skupnostih, da okrepite svoje sposobnosti in se povežete z drugimi razvijalci. Ne pozabite, da so izkušnje v Rustu pridobljene s predanostjo in nenehno prakso, zato naj vas ne bo strah podati se v nove projekte in izzive.

Uvod: Razumevanje pomena izkušenj v Rustu

Rust je sodoben programski jezik, zasnovan za zagotavljanje večje varnosti in zmogljivosti za razvijalce. Trenutno, je postala priljubljena izbira za tiste, ki želijo zgraditi zanesljive in učinkovite aplikacije. Da pa obvladate Rust in postanete strokovni programer, je ključnega pomena pridobiti praktične izkušnje z jezikom.

Izkušnje z Rustom so bistvene za razumevanje njegove edinstvene sintakse in funkcij preverjanja napak med prevajanjem. Z delom na resničnih projektih in soočanjem z izzivi, ki se pojavljajo med razvojem, lahko programerji Poglobite svoje znanje o upravljanju pomnilnika v Rust in se naučite, kako izkoristiti njegove prednosti za pisanje varnejše in učinkovitejše kode.

Ekskluzivna vsebina - Kliknite tukaj  Kakšne so omejitve programa Flash Builder?

Eden od načinov pridobivanja izkušenj v Rustu je sodelujejo pri odprtokodnih projektih. Prispevanje k obstoječim projektom daje programerjem priložnost, da sodelujejo z drugimi izkušenimi razvijalci in izboljšajo svoje veščine Rust. Poleg tega razvijalci lahko s pregledovanjem in razumevanjem kode, ki so jo napisali drugi Pridobite dragoceno znanje o najboljših praksah in vzorcih oblikovanja v jeziku.

Raziskovanje spletnih virov: Poiščite spletne vadnice, dokumentacijo in vaje za izboljšanje svojih veščin Rust

Odličen način za pridobivanje izkušenj v Rja je z raziskovanjem spletnih virov, ki so na voljo. Našli boste široko paleto vadnice ki vas bo korak za korakom vodil skozi osnove jezika in vam pomagal razumeti njegovo sintakso in delovanje. Poleg tega boste lahko dostopali do širokega dokumentacija kjer boste našli podrobne informacije o različnih funkcijah in knjižnicah Rust. Ti viri vam bodo dali trdne temelje, na katerih boste lahko gradili svoje veščine in znanje v tem zmogljivem programskem jeziku.

Drug način za izboljšanje vaših veščin Rust je s prakso. Išče ejercicios spletu, ki vas izziva, da uporabite svoje znanje in rešite težave s tem jezikom. Te vaje vam bodo omogočile, da se seznanite s posebnostmi in izzivi, ki jih lahko predstavlja Rust, ter okrepile vašo sposobnost prepoznavanja učinkovitih in elegantnih rešitev.

Poleg spletnih virov je odličen način za pridobivanje izkušenj v Rustu ta, da se pridružite skupnost razvijalcev, ki uporabljajo ta jezik. Sodelujte v skupinah za razprave, forumih in spletnih skupnostih, kjer lahko komunicirate z drugimi programerji, postavljate vprašanja, delite svoje izkušnje in se učite od drugih. Skupnost Rust je znana kot prijazna in gostoljubna, zato ne oklevajte in izkoristite to priložnost za razširitev svojih veščin in znanja.

Prispevek k odprtokodnim projektom: Naučite se sodelovati s skupnostjo Rust in pridobite praktične izkušnje pri delu na resničnih projektih

Sodelovanje pri odprtokodnih projektih je odličen način za pridobivanje izkušenj z Rust in izboljšanje vaših veščin programiranja. Če se pridružite skupnosti Rust, boste imeli priložnost delati na resničnih projektih skupaj z izkušenimi razvijalci. Ta praktična izkušnja vam bo omogočila, da se iz prve roke naučite najboljših praks razvoja programske opreme in se seznanite z ekosistemom Rust.

Če prispevate k odprtokodnim projektom v Rustu, boste imeli tudi priložnost, da timsko delo z drugimi razvijalci in zgraditi dragocene poklicne odnose. Sodelovanje pri odprtokodnih projektih vključuje interakcijo z ljudmi iz različnih okolij in ravni izkušenj, kar vam daje priložnost, da se od njih učite in razširite svojo poklicno mrežo. Poleg tega vam bodo konstruktivne povratne informacije skupnosti Rust pomagale izboljšati vaše sposobnosti in tehnično znanje.

Ena od prednosti prispevanja k odprtokodnim projektom v Rustu je možnost, da neposredno vplivajo na jezik in njegov ekosistem. S sodelovanjem pri realnih projektih lahko predstavite ideje, reševanje problemov in naredite izboljšave, ki koristijo skupnosti Rust kot celoti. To vam ne daje samo zadovoljstva, da prispevate k živahni skupnosti, temveč vam omogoča tudi krepitev sposobnosti reševanja problemov in kritičnega mišljenja.

Udeležba na srečanjih in konferencah: Udeležite se dogodkov Rust, da se povežete z drugimi navdušenci in se učite od strokovnjakov na tem področju

Če želite pridobiti izkušnje z Rustom, je eden najboljših načinov za to udeležba na srečanjih in konferencah, posvečenih temu programskemu jeziku. Na teh dogodkih boste imeli priložnost, da povežite se z drugimi navdušenci nad Rust ter deliti znanje in ideje. Poleg tega lahko učijo od strokovnjakov na tem področju ki bodo z Rustom delili svoje izkušnje in najboljše prakse pri razvoju.

Ekskluzivna vsebina - Kliknite tukaj  Kako Flash Builder pospeši razvoj?

Udeležba na srečanjih in konferencah Rust vam bo dala neposredna izpostavljenost napredku in novicam na svetu iz Rja. Lahko boste na tekočem z najnovejšimi posodobitvami, novimi funkcijami in jezikovnimi izboljšavami. Ta izkušnja vam bo omogočila, da svoje znanje posodabljate in ostanete na tekočem z najboljšimi razvojnimi praksami v Rustu.

Druga prednost udeležbe na teh dogodkih je, da boste lahko mreženje s strokovnjaki iz industrije ki vas zanima Rust. Vzpostavljanje stikov z ljudmi z izkušnjami v jeziku lahko odpre vrata zaposlitvenim priložnostim in sodelovanju pri zanimivih projektih. Poleg tega boste z interakcijo z drugimi navdušenci lahko odprite se novim perspektivam in pristopom ki vam bo pomagal rasti kot razvijalec Rust.

Izvajanje osebnih projektov: Izzovite se z ustvarjanjem osebnih projektov v Rustu, da razvijete svoje sposobnosti in uporabite svoje znanje

Ko gre za pridobivanje izkušenj v Rustu, je eden najboljših načinov za to dokončanje osebnih projektov. Ni boljšega načina za izzvati te sebi in uporabite svoje sposobnosti in znanje v praksi v tem programskem jeziku. Z delom na osebnih projektih v Rustu se lahko spopadete s kompleksnimi problemi in uporabite inovativne rešitve z uporabo edinstvenih funkcij Rusta.

Pri ustvarjanju osebnih projektov v Rustu imate priložnost, da razvijati svoje sposobnosti programiranja in se poglobite v ključne koncepte tega jezika. Ko se soočate z resničnimi izzivi in ​​si prizadevate najti rešitve, boste pridobili praktične izkušnje in postali boljši programer Rust. Poleg tega je skupnost Rust zelo aktivna in podpira, kar pomeni, da boste lahko našli vire, nasvete in pomoč, kadar koli jo potrebujete.

Druga prednost izvajanja osebnih projektov v Rustu je ta lahko uporabite svoje znanje na različnih področjih. Razvijate lahko namizne aplikacije, ustvarjate učinkovita orodja ukazne vrstice, gradite spletni strežniki hitro in varno ter celo izvajati projekte z Rust v vgrajenih sistemih. Vsestranskost Rusta vam omogoča, da raziskujete različna področja programiranja in postanete visoko usposobljeni razvijalec v tem jeziku.

Poiščite pripravništvo ali plačana dela: Pridobite delovne izkušnje v Rustu s pripravništvom ali plačanimi službami, kar vam omogoča, da se učite od izkušenih strokovnjakov

Iskanje priložnosti za pripravništvo ali plačanih služb na področju Rust je lahko odličen način za pridobivanje praktičnih izkušenj in krepitev vaših sposobnosti. Z udeležbo na praksi ali plačanem delu se boste imeli priložnost poglobiti v resnične projekte in sodelovati z izkušenimi strokovnjaki. To vam bo dalo neprecenljiv vpogled v to, kako se koda razvija, uvaja in vzdržuje v Rustu. Če želite poiskati te priložnosti, lahko iščete specializirana spletna mesta ali ponudbe za delo podjetij, ki sodelujejo z Rustom.

Ko pri Rustu najdete priložnost za pripravništvo ali plačano zaposlitev, je bistveno, da kar najbolje izkoristite svoje izkušnje. Zastavite si jasne cilje in jih sporočite svojim nadrejenim ali mentorjem. To vam bo pomagalo, da se osredotočite in kar najbolje izkoristite priložnosti za učenje. Aktivno sodelujte na timskih sestankih in razpravah Omogočil vam bo, da se seznanite s praksami in procesi razvoja Rust ter se učite iz izkušenj drugih. Poleg tega porabite čas za raziskovanje in preučevanje ključnih konceptov Rust okrepiti svoje tehnične sposobnosti in ohraniti nenehno učenje. Ne oklevajte z vprašanji in izkoristite vsako priložnost za povratne informacije in nasvete strokovnjakov, s katerimi delate.

Ko je vaše pripravništvo ali plačano delo pri Rustu končano, je bistveno, da lahko pokažete, kaj ste se naučili in spretnosti, ki ste jih pridobili. Projekte, na katerih ste delali, vključite v svoj osebni portfelj in izpostavite najpomembnejše dosežke in rezultate. Lahko tudi ti prispevati k odprtokodnemu programu Rust da še naprej krepite svoje sposobnosti in postanete vidni v skupnosti razvijalcev Rust. Ne pozabite, da čeprav je pripravništvo ali plačana služba odličen način za pridobivanje izkušenj, se učenje in rast tu ne ustavita. Še naprej se izzivajte, bodite na tekočem z najnovejšimi trendi in napredkom v Rustu ter iščite nove priložnosti za nadaljnji razvoj svojih veščin v tem vznemirljivem programskem jeziku.

Ekskluzivna vsebina - Kliknite tukaj  ¿Cómo mido el rendimiento de mi sitio con Edge Tools & Services?

Sodelovanje v mentorskih programih: Izkoristite priložnost, da vas mentorirajo strokovnjaki za Rust, ki vas bodo vodili in svetovali za izboljšanje vaše izkušnje v jeziku

Sodelovanje v mentorskih programih: Izkoristite priložnost, da vas mentorirajo Rust strokovnjaki, ki vas bodo vodili in svetovali za izboljšanje vaše izkušnje v jeziku.

Eden najboljših načinov pridobivanja izkušenj v Rustu so mentorski programi. Ti programi vam dajejo priložnost, da vas vodijo jezikovni strokovnjaki, ki vam bodo pomagali razumeti ključne pojme in ponudili dragocene nasvete za izboljšajte svojo spretnost programiranje v Rustu. S sodelovanjem v mentorskem programu se lahko učite od izkušenih ljudi in dobite prilagojene povratne informacije o vaši kodi. Ta neposredna interakcija vam bo omogočila rast kot razvijalec in pospešila vaše učenje.

Mentorski programi so lahko strukturirani ali neformalni, odvisno od vaših želja in razpoložljivosti časa. Nekatere organizacije ponujajo programe, kjer vam dodelijo mentorja, s katerim boste delali določeno obdobje. Ta mentorstva običajno vključujejo občasne sestanke, na katerih boste razpravljali o svojem napredku in prejeli smernice v vaših projektih in imeli boste priložnost postavljati vprašanja. Poleg tega lahko mentorje iščete tudi samostojno. Obstajajo spletne skupnosti in forumi, kjer se lahko povežete z razvijalci Rust, ki so pripravljeni deliti svoje znanje in vam pomagati na vaši poti do strokovnega znanja o Rust. Ne podcenjujte moči mentorja pri razvoju svojih tehničnih veščin.

Sodelovanje v mentorskih programih vam ne daje le priložnosti, da pridobite tehnične veščine v Rustu, ampak vam omogoča tudi mreženje v skupnosti razvijalcev jezikov. Tudi tako, da imaš nekoga, ki te lahko vodi in nuditi podporo, se boste v Rustu počutili motivirane in podprte na vaši poti do odličnosti. Ne oklevajte in izkoristite to priložnost, saj je dragocena naložba v vašo poklicno rast in vam bo omogočila hitrejše in učinkovitejše doseganje vaših ciljev.

Izdelava in objava odprtokodnih projektov: Razvijte lastne odprtokodne projekte v Rustu in jih delite s skupnostjo, da dvignete svoj profil in pridobite priznanje

Eden najboljših načinov pridobivanja izkušenj v Rustu je ustvarjanje in objavljanje projektov Odprtokodna programska oprema. Razvijanje lastnih odprtokodnih projektov v Rustu vam daje priložnost, da se naučite in izboljšate svoje sposobnosti v tem sodobnem in varnem sistemskem programskem jeziku.

Skupnost Rust je zelo aktivna in gostoljubna, zaradi česar je idealno okolje za deljenje vaših projektov in pridobivanje prepoznavnosti. Z objavo svojih odprtokodnih projektov boste prispevali k ekosistemu Rust in drugim razvijalcem omogočili uporabo vaše kode, jo izboljšali in prilagodili svojim potrebam.

Poleg tega, da izboljšate svoj profil kot razvijalec, vam sodelovanje pri odprtokodnih projektih omogoča timsko delo, učenje od drugih programerjev in pridobivanje izkušenj pri reševanju resničnih problemov. Raznolikost razpoložljivih projektov vam daje priložnost, da raziščete različna področja zanimanja, od spletni razvoj in programiranje mobilnih na vgrajene sisteme ali analiza podatkov. To vam bo pomagalo razširiti vaša obzorja in postati bolj vsestranski in vsestranski razvijalec.